Narrative:
THE PLT REPORTED THAT DURING THE LANDING APCH, APRX 1/2 MILE FROM TOUCHDOWN, THE ACFT DESCENDED BELOW THE VISUAL GLIDEPATH. RECOVERY WAS ATTEMPTED WITH THE APPLICATION OF POWER, HOWEVER, THE ACFT MUSHED INTO A FIELD SHORT OF THE RWY. THE ACFT ROLLED, STRUCK A ROADWAY AT THE RWY THRESHOLD AND BOUNCED ONTO THE ARPT IN A LEFT WING LOW ATTITUDE.
